While this may be important towards the physical integration of the Qt pane 
that will be the gui frontend for the Neovim core, this doesn't need to be 
finished to start working on the "plumbing" that will need set up between 
Leo and the neovim core, e.g., nvim.exe.

The "plumbing" is msgpack calls to the neovim core and some msgpack calls 
from neovim to a as yet unwritten interface in Leo.  For experiments you 
can just have Leo talk to a separately running instance of the stock Qt 
fronted Neovim.
